    Decent small town comfort food. Comfortable townie environment. Looks like the whole town eats here. Arrived at 9PM and there had to be 25 cars in the lot. The Chicken Parm with Spaghetti came with a basic salad and decent garlic bread for $9.50. Good portion, fresh chicken and filled me up. Nice folks here. I'll be back.
